8.14. Switching camera angles
[BD Video]
BD
VIDEO
BD
VIDEO
[DVD Video]
DVD
VIDEO
DVD
VIDEO
Some BD-Videos and DVD-Videos contain scenes which have been shot simultaneously from various angles. You can
change the camera angle when
appears on the TV screen.
1.
During playback, press
[MODE]
to display the play menu.
2.
Use
[
]
to select “Angle”, then press
[OK]
.
3.
Use
[
]
to select your desired angle, then press
[OK]
.
4.
Press
[MODE]
to exit.
Note
D
• If “Angle Mark” setting is set to “Off”,
will not appear on the TV screen.
8.15. Noise reduction
[BD Video]
BD
VIDEO
BD
VIDEO
[DVD Video]
DVD
VIDEO
DVD
VIDEO
[AVCHD]
AVCHD
AVCHD
Reduces the noise of the playback picture.
1.
Press
[HOME]
to access the home menu.
2.
Use
[
]
to select “Setup”, then press
[OK]
.
3.
Use
[
]
to select “
”, then press
[OK]
.
4.
Use
[
]
to select “Picture Control”, then press
[OK]
.
5.
Use
[
]
to select “Noise Reduction”, then press
[OK]
.
6.
Use
[
]
to select your desired setting, then press
[OK]
.
7.
Press
[HOME]
to exit.
Note
D
• With regard to the setting value, the larger the value is, the more notably the effect appears.
8.16. Closed caption
[BD Video]
BD
VIDEO
BD
VIDEO
[DVD Video]
DVD
VIDEO
DVD
VIDEO
[AVCHD]
AVCHD
AVCHD
Closed Caption displays subtitles in synchronization with the Video.
1.
During playback, press
[MODE]
to display the play menu.
2.
Use
[
]
to select “CC Select”, then press
[OK]
.
3.
Use
[
]
to select your desired stream, then press
[OK]
.
4.
Press
[MODE]
to exit.
Note
D
• Configure
the
closed caption display settings (font color, size, style, etc.) in the setup in advance. Refer to page
34-35.
